Tariff dispute escalated: GDL rejects City-Bahn offer

industrial action at City-Bahn Chemnitz:

The collective bargaining between the GDL union and the City-Bahn in Chemnitz failed again. Despite an offer of the city railway to reduce working hours to 35 hours a week without reducing a removal, the GDL described the offer as a provocation. The union criticized that the supposed improvement would ultimately have to be financed by the GDL members themselves, which is not acceptable for them. The union chair Claus Weselsky emphasized that such a procedure would not be tolerated. This is not the first time that the city railway and the GDL are involved in an industrial action, there have already been 15 strikes.

The City-Bahn works in Chemnitz and on various railway lines in Central and West Saxony and employs around 185 people. Despite the failure of the collective bargaining, there has been no official statement from the company on the current developments.
